**Mgmt Meeting Minutes — Retiring the Brightline Range**

Quick recap for sales leads at Fenholt Supplies: we agreed to retire the Brightline fixture range by year-end. Remaining stock moves to clearance pricing next month, and accounts on standing orders get migrated to the Lumetta range. Trade-in incentives were approved in principle. The confidential note on next steps sits just below.

board note of bajof-bajeg: The pricing group signed off on a budget of $13.4 million for Project Sildor. The renewal with Lamixek Holdings closes at $48.9 million a year, 49 percent above the last contract.

Ticket: Staging env misconfigured for Siftgate bloom filter

The bloom layer in front of the Pellet KV store is rejecting all lookups in staging because the env file was copied from the dev template without credentials. False-positive tuning values are fine; only the auth line is missing. To unblock the weekly demo, the Pellet admission secret must be set on the following line.

env line for yaguf-fajop: LEDGER_TOKEN13=fb08984397349

## Deployment

Dark mode for the Opsgrove admin dashboard ships as a theme bundle, not a code change. No new endpoints, no new permissions. Theme preference is stored client-side only; nothing touches the session store. The bundle is built in the same pipeline as the main app and signed identically. CSP is unchanged — all styles are first-party. Rollback is a single asset revert. For review, the dashboard deploys with the configuration that follows.

service settings:
PRAIX_LOG_LEVEL=error
PRAIX_METRICS_HOST=metrics.praix.qorvelcorp.corp
PRAIX_POOL_SIZE=16

## Service Accounts: The Great FD Leak Hunt

Quick note before you review: the `svc-muxley` account was holding ~4k leaked file descriptors because the Quillport poller never closed sockets on retry. We patched the retry loop and cycled the account. While hunting, we also noticed the old credentials were baked into three cron jobs, so everything got rotated. The poller now authenticates against Brindlegate with the refreshed key below.

API key for kahop-bagef: zpat2_yb